Hi has anyone exchanged into a resort that they had already went to and now were in the 1 in 4 year rule delima, and did resort refuse your exchange?
Thank you
Linda:confused:
 
I was shut out of Sheraton's Vistana in Kissimmee, FL but got around it by renting. I got a rental through a company for not too much more than the cost of MF (if I'd owned a week there). There are some credible companies that specialize in renting timeshare weeks and sometimes the price is very reasonable. Search the boards here for such companies -- I don't remember the one I used.
 
Which resorts use the 1 in 4 rule for exchanging?
 
Grand Pacific Resort has been know to enforce...

The Grand Pacific Resorts, primarily in So Calif has been know to cancel vacations if you violate the 1 in 4 rule for any of their resorts. Primarily they are...

Carlsbad Inn (Carlsbad, CA)
Grand Pacific Palisades (Carlsbad, CA)
Carlsbad Seapoint (Carlsbad, CA)
Southern Calif Beach Club (Oceanside, CA)
Villa L'Auberge (Del Mar, CA) (I think?)
Coronado Beach Resort
Alii Kai, Kauai (I think?)
Red Wolf Lakeside Lodge, in Tahoe (maybe??)

These resorts trade primarily in RCI. Only a few can exchange with II.

You can see the list in the RCI directory/on line in the resort info. The info also restates the 1 in 4 rule.

Exchangers etc. report that they manged to slip by the 1 in 4 rule---but there are also stories that the exchange is canceled at the last minute. Why it takes the exchange co. until the last minute---I don't know!

Anybody know the answer to this: If the resort trades in both II and RCI, does the 1 in 4 apply to both exchange companies? Or could you go trade one year through RCI and the next through II, and they would both be legitimate trades that wouldn't/couldn't be cancelled?
 
The 1-in-4 rule is an RCI thing. II does not have any restrictions about trading into a resort. So one strategy is to trade through RCI one year and then trade through II (or one of the independent exchange companies). Good luck!

Evelyn
 
RCI does enforce the 1-in-4 rule, but it is the resorts that request it. II doesn't allow resorts to do it, is my understanding, which is strange because there are more upscale resorts with II, like the Marriotts, Hyatts and Sheraton/Starwood/Westins.

RCI should back off on the restrictions because it makes for a large inventory of some resorts. Why was I able to get a Hilton Seaworld 3 bedroom one year out with a blue week? Because the 1-in-4 keeps that inventory from a large percentage of people with better traders. We bought at PAHIO to get around the 1-in-4 rule.

I love II! Love those Marriotts! I specifically am talking about Disney. If it wasn't for II, we would have to plan our trips differently, always going to different resorts, but because II doesn't have restrictions, we can have our favorite resorts.
 
Also a reminder that if you own at the resort you are exempt from the 1 in 4 rule. We have back to back weeks booked at Christmas next year at Pacific Shores on Vancouver Island because we own the Christmas week and were able to exchange an October Big Sky unit for the New Year's week.
 
Sometimes you are exempt within a "family" of resorts

I should add that sometimes you are exempt with a family of resorts IF you OWN ONE of the FAMILY. This is true for the Grand Pacific Resorts-if you own at say, Carlsbad Inn, you can trade into it or Grand Pacific Palisades or Carlsbad Seapoint as often as you want. We own at Grand Pacific because it suits us best-and to get around the 1 in 4 rule for the other GPR resorts since we live in Nor Cal and like to vacation So Cal coastal. I'm guessing there are other "famillies" with the same rules. Maybe Pahio?
